- Brief Summary
The purpose of this study is to learn more about how octreotide (Sandostatin LAR® Depot) affects levels of ghrelin, hunger, and body weight in people with Prader-Willi Syndrome.
- Detailed Description
After baseline tests, a nurse will administer monthly injections of Sandostatin LAR® or placebo for 6 months. At the end of this initial 6-month treatment period and a 4-month washout period, study subjects will then crossover to receive the alternative therapy (placebo or octreotide) for an additional 6 months. Subjects will be followed for 16 months total at scheduled visits: 0, 2, 6, 10, 12, and 16 months (Table 2).

Group Intervention Description Placebo Placebo Normal Saline Octreotide Octreotide They will be admitted to the inpatient unit of the OCTRI for testing six times. During each of these visits, testing will include measuring how well glucose (sugar) is processed, how much energy is burned off as heat, their amount of body fat, levels of the hormone ghrelin, and how much food is eaten at a meal. After the first study visit, subjects will begin monthly treatment with either the study drug or a placebo (an inactive substance), which will be continued for the first six months of the study. For the last six months of the study, subjects will be switched to the opposite treatment. During these study periods participants will return monthly for administration of study medication, physical examination, and blood draw to check liver enzymes.
